The Group Five Bursary was a South African funding program for students studying civil, mechanical, or electrical engineering, quantity surveying, and construction management. It covered major study costs such as tuition and accommodation while combining academic studies with mandatory vacation work and practical on-site training. Recipients were usually required to complete a work-back period after graduation.http://www.g5.co.za/careers_student.php

Group Five Bursary South Africa Overview

Group Five (G5) is a well-known South African construction and engineering company established in 1974. It has delivered major projects across Africa in infrastructure, buildings, mining, and real estate.

In the past, Group Five offered a bursary program to support students in construction-related fields. The program provided funding plus practical exposure through vacation work and graduate development.

Important update for March 2026: Group Five will not be offering bursaries this year. The official bursary application page clearly states this, and the company is currently in business rescue proceedings (with termination expected in the first or second quarter of 2026).

Selection Process for Group Five Bursary South Africa

To qualify for the Group Five Bursary, applicants must be South African citizens with a minimum 60% average in Mathematics and Science and be studying or planning to study engineering or construction-related fields at a recognized South African university or university of technology.

Applications are usually submitted through the Group Five careers or bursary page and must include a CV, certified ID, and academic records. Applications are first screened to ensure all requirements are met, after which shortlisted candidates may be invited for interviews.

Successful bursary recipients are typically required to complete vacation work at Group Five sites during university breaks to gain practical experience. They may also be required to sign a work-back agreement, committing to work for the company for a period equal to the years of bursary funding.
